28 /*
29  * Not all of the MIPS CPUs have the "wait" instruction available. Moreover,
30  * the implementation of the "wait" feature differs between CPU families. This
31  * points to the function that implements CPU specific wait.
32  * The wait instruction stops the pipeline and reduces the power consumption of
33  * the CPU very much.
34  */
35 void (*cpu_wait)(void);
36 EXPORT_SYMBOL(cpu_wait);
37
38 static void r3081_wait(void)
39 {
40         unsigned long cfg = read_c0_conf();
41         write_c0_conf(cfg | R30XX_CONF_HALT);
42 }
43
44 static void r39xx_wait(void)
45 {
46         local_irq_disable();
47         if (!need_resched())
48                 write_c0_conf(read_c0_conf() | TX39_CONF_HALT);
49         local_irq_enable();
50 }
51
52 extern void r4k_wait(void);
53
54 /*
55  * This variant is preferable as it allows testing need_resched and going to
56  * sleep depending on the outcome atomically.  Unfortunately the "It is
57  * implementation-dependent whether the pipeline restarts when a non-enabled
58  * interrupt is requested" restriction in the MIPS32/MIPS64 architecture makes
59  * using this version a gamble.
60  */
61 void r4k_wait_irqoff(void)
62 {
63         local_irq_disable();
64         if (!need_resched())
65                 __asm__("       .set    push            \n"
66                         "       .set    mips3           \n"
67                         "       wait                    \n"
68                         "       .set    pop             \n");
69         local_irq_enable();
70         __asm__("       .globl __pastwait       \n"
71                 "__pastwait:                    \n");
72         return;
73 }
74
75 /*
76  * The RM7000 variant has to handle erratum 38.  The workaround is to not
77  * have any pending stores when the WAIT instruction is executed.
78  */
79 static void rm7k_wait_irqoff(void)
80 {
81         local_irq_disable();
82         if (!need_resched())
83                 __asm__(
84                 "       .set    push                                    \n"
85                 "       .set    mips3                                   \n"
86                 "       .set    noat                                    \n"
87                 "       mfc0    $1, $12                                 \n"
88                 "       sync                                            \n"
89                 "       mtc0    $1, $12         # stalls until W stage  \n"
90                 "       wait                                            \n"
91                 "       mtc0    $1, $12         # stalls until W stage  \n"
92                 "       .set    pop                                     \n");
93         local_irq_enable();
94 }
95
96 /*
97  * The Au1xxx wait is available only if using 32khz counter or
98  * external timer source, but specifically not CP0 Counter.
99  * alchemy/common/time.c may override cpu_wait!
100  */
101 static void au1k_wait(void)
102 {
103         __asm__("       .set    mips3                   \n"
104                 "       cache   0x14, 0(%0)             \n"
105                 "       cache   0x14, 32(%0)            \n"
106                 "       sync                            \n"
107                 "       nop                             \n"
108                 "       wait                            \n"
109                 "       nop                             \n"
110                 "       nop                             \n"
111                 "       nop                             \n"
112                 "       nop                             \n"
113                 "       .set    mips0                   \n"
114                 : : "r" (au1k_wait));
115 }
116
117 static int __initdata nowait;
118
119 static int __init wait_disable(char *s)
120 {
121         nowait = 1;
122
123         return 1;
124 }
125
126 __setup("nowait", wait_disable);
127
128 void __init check_wait(void)
129 {
130         struct cpuinfo_mips *c = &current_cpu_data;
131
132         if (nowait) {
133                 printk("Wait instruction disabled.\n");
134                 return;
135         }
136
137         switch (c->cputype) {
138         case CPU_R3081:
139         case CPU_R3081E:
140                 cpu_wait = r3081_wait;
141                 break;
142         case CPU_TX3927:
143                 cpu_wait = r39xx_wait;
144                 break;
145         case CPU_R4200:
146 /*      case CPU_R4300: */
147         case CPU_R4600:
148         case CPU_R4640:
149         case CPU_R4650:
150         case CPU_R4700:
151         case CPU_R5000:
152         case CPU_R5500:
153         case CPU_NEVADA:
154         case CPU_4KC:
155         case CPU_4KEC:
156         case CPU_4KSC:
157         case CPU_5KC:
158         case CPU_25KF:
159         case CPU_PR4450:
160         case CPU_BCM3302:
161         case CPU_BCM6338:
162         case CPU_BCM6348:
163         case CPU_BCM6358:
164         case CPU_CAVIUM_OCTEON:
165         case CPU_CAVIUM_OCTEON_PLUS:
166                 cpu_wait = r4k_wait;
167                 break;
168
169         case CPU_RM7000:
170                 cpu_wait = rm7k_wait_irqoff;
171                 break;
172
173         case CPU_24K:
174         case CPU_34K:
175         case CPU_1004K:
176                 cpu_wait = r4k_wait;
177                 if (read_c0_config7() & MIPS_CONF7_WII)
178                         cpu_wait = r4k_wait_irqoff;
179                 break;
180
181         case CPU_74K:
182                 cpu_wait = r4k_wait;
183                 if ((c->processor_id & 0xff) >= PRID_REV_ENCODE_332(2, 1, 0))
184                         cpu_wait = r4k_wait_irqoff;
185                 break;
186
187         case CPU_TX49XX:
188                 cpu_wait = r4k_wait_irqoff;
189                 break;
190         case CPU_ALCHEMY:
191                 cpu_wait = au1k_wait;
192                 break;
193         case CPU_20KC:
194                 /*
195                  * WAIT on Rev1.0 has E1, E2, E3 and E16.
196                  * WAIT on Rev2.0 and Rev3.0 has E16.
197                  * Rev3.1 WAIT is nop, why bother
198                  */
199                 if ((c->processor_id & 0xff) <= 0x64)
200                         break;
201
202                 /*
203                  * Another rev is incremeting c0_count at a reduced clock
204                  * rate while in WAIT mode.  So we basically have the choice
205                  * between using the cp0 timer as clocksource or avoiding
206                  * the WAIT instruction.  Until more details are known,
207                  * disable the use of WAIT for 20Kc entirely.
208                    cpu_wait = r4k_wait;
209                  */
210                 break;
211         case CPU_RM9000:
212                 if ((c->processor_id & 0x00ff) >= 0x40)
213                         cpu_wait = r4k_wait;
214                 break;
215         default:
216                 break;
217         }
218 }
